Delving into the work itself, this is not the sort of job you tackle with a one size fits all mentality. Old storefronts, painted trim, brick facades, and wood decks each demand a different approach. A brick wall might respond well to a medium pressure wash followed by a gentle rinse and a careful inspection for loose mortar. A wooden shake roof or timber porch might require a softer touch and a milder cleaning solution that protects grain and color. Concrete sidewalks can take higher pressure, but the risk of chipping and pitting needs to be weighed against the benefits of a truly refreshed surface. For residents and visitors, there is a practical logic behind hiring a trusted power washing company. It is not just about removing dirt; it is about extending the life of surfaces. Stone, brick, vinyl siding, and concrete all respond differently to cleaning methods. A skilled operator knows when to use hot water, when to apply a cleaning solution, and how long to dwell before rinsing. If this sounds like a small technical decision, it is not. It translates into cost savings over time, fewer repairs, and less frequent renovations. There are trade-offs in this field, as in any service business. The most obvious is cost versus value. A lower price might be appealing in the short run, but it often comes with compromises on equipment, safety, or the scope of work. A more thorough clean with better protective measures can be more expensive, yet it results in less risk of damage and longer intervals between cleanings. The best clients learn to see value in the longer horizon: slower, careful cleaning that preserves surface texture and color, followed by a plan for routine maintenance. The decision is not about chasing the cheapest option but about finding a partner who understands the street’s needs and the homeowner’s goals.

Edge cases are part of the job. On an older, historic storefront, there may be painted letters that should not be scrubbed with aggressive methods. On a modern building with sensitive coatings, you may require specialty cleaners or gentle touch washers. In these moments, the contractor must provide options, explain the risks and benefits, and help the client choose a path that balances preservation with practical cleanliness. The good contractor does not pretend every surface is the same, and a genuine commitment to customization distinguishes the best teams from the rest.

Two practical notes for readers who want to explore this work in person or reach out for services. The first is the value of seeing is believing. If you are curious about the difference a professional cleaning can make, ask for before and after photos from previous projects. A reputable company will be able to show tangible results that match the needs of your own space. The second note is the importance of a clear plan. Before any work begins, talk through the surfaces involved, the products to be used, the expected timeline, and any potential risks. A well-structured plan reduces surprises and helps you coordinate with tenants, if relevant, and with neighboring property owners who might be affected by the work.
